SENSIBLE SOLUTIONS Educational responsibilities do not end with the hiring of teachersg continuing student welfare and development must still be maintained. Provid- ing a quality education for students in a safe envi- ronment is the major aim of our school district, according to superintendent Joseph Meler, Jr. Mr. Meler had previously served as principal of E.M.H.S. Returning to our community after eleven years absence, Mr. Meler was hired in 1978 1 as superintendent. Following Mr. Senecalis tragic death in December, Mr. Meler became acting high school principal.

Iohn Senecal 7930-7980 T he Eagle Mountain community suffered a very real shock, a strong sense of loss, and a painful setback with the death of Jack Senecal. Eagle Mountian High School princi- pal for four years, Jack Senecal represented the school and its young people to the best of his ability. He was sincere and earnest in his efforts to be as fair as possible with stu- dents, and he cared a great deal about their programs and welfare. He was admired and respected by all those who knew and worked with him. He was the most honest and intelligent person I have ever had the privilege of knowing. I was proud to be his friend. He was sincere and earnest in his effort to make E.M. a welcome part of the Arrowhead League. These comments about Mr. Jack Senecal were made by people who wokred for and with him. His dedi- cated administration helped greatly to make the 1980-81 year a success both academically and extracurricularly for the students of E.M.H.S. A John Senecal, Principal. L Students, faculty, and community honored John Senecal at a December 19th Memorial Service.
